Throw the Perfect Celebration at Ubud Pool Bar
Enjoy the Adventure of Live Sports and Great Food at a Welcoming Sports BarIt's more than just a video game day; it's a common experience that brings people with each other. What makes a sports bar genuinely special?The Ultimate Video Game Day ExperienceWhen you stroll into a sports bar on video game day, you can feel the electrical environment hum